Wedding ceremony day. Paul cleans and assessments our stuff for 1–2 hours earlier than we depart. At this level, a tick list is very important—forgetting equipment isn’t an choice! Paul’s view of ‘Our equipment’. The bundle determines the marriage’s period.
Publish-wedding. We begin downloading footage once we get house to have a backup. See ‘Copying footage for your PC’. If we will’t obtain, we will stay the playing cards with us. Our Canon cameras have dual playing cards for backup. We will render previews and depart the PC in a single day after downloading the photographs. ‘Backing up’.
We will kind images after downloading, rendering, and backing up. Lightroom organizes and edits our weddings. I’m going to get started through reviewing their preview images to find those that expose the entire story. At all times come with a lovely bride. Even though obvious, it may be overpassed. If conceivable, we come with moms.
We tweak round 100 footage to percentage at this level.
Storywriting follows…
On-line wedding ceremony previews come with story and images. The pair too can view the footage first. We display them the tale and be offering to mend anything else. Tag them on Fb to start out the commenting and “liking frenzy.”
We then make a selection their ultimate images from their number one stock. While you’ve snapped 1000’s of footage, evaluating them and opting for the most productive can take awhile! That is a very powerful since extra isn’t at all times higher. After settling on the best images, we must undergo once more to take away duplicates and different mistakes. About 30% of the images are decided on for black-and-white conversion at this step. We goal for 100 footage each hour throughout weddings. It sort of feels like so much, nevertheless it provides up rapid! This spares us from having to revisit the gathering if the bride and groom desire a black-and-white symbol in colour.
Corrections apply. We edit every picture for colour, publicity, straightening, and cropping. If wanted, we will dodge and burn the picture. This step can take an afternoon or two. Scott Kelby has nice Lightroom and Photoshop books.
Ultimate detailing follows fundamental fixes. We take away undesirable blemishes, melt harsh traces from deficient lighting fixtures, and switch heads in circle of relatives footage (anyone is repeatedly winking!). We additionally black and white the chosen images. Phew, virtually there!
To make sharing images on-line more uncomplicated for our brides and grooms, we export all photographs to full-resolution JPEGs and social media-sized photographs. We retailer the overall photographs on Blu-ray, exhausting pressure, and off-site exhausting pressure.
